Shops in Langley Mill
replied on: 10/27/2004 7:23:00 PM

Hello rob
The barber on station road that you refer to was non other than JOE,S---- as kids it was a no' 1 all over for us, i remember joe cos he was bald.
But best of all he kept the beach nut chewing gum on the front of the counter in easy reach of my little 6 year old mitts, when he wasn't looking i helped myself!!! yes i was a naughty little boy, always in trouble with the local bobby (mick patrick)!!
It was nice to see malc again, it was just an off-chance visit as i was visiting my brother who has decided to live on a barge on the" basin" canal.
Yes theres not much that malc doesnt know about langley mill, he is a nice guy too.
